Kubernetes Event Disappears After 60mins
Copy Markdown
Open in ChatGPT
Open in Claude
Problem
- Kubernetes Event Disappears After 60mins
- Storing Kubernetes Events Persistently
Environment
- Platform9 Managed Kubernetes - All Versions
Answer
- By default, Kubernetes events have a life span of 1-hour duration for easing the burden on ETCD, which is noted in this upstream feature request. This default value of 1 hour is customizable with
kube-apiserverflag--event-ttl <duration>flag. - To persistently store events, there are upstream projects like Eventrouter. But note that this project is not directly maintained by Platform9.
